Veniero's http://www.venierospastry.com/
342 East 11th Street @ First Avenue
Great cheesecake, killer canolis, and other pastries. Around holidays the line to the counter is over an hour long.

MADAME X (haha)
94 West Houston Street
on the north side between LaGuardia Place and Thompson Street

(its very close or next to YAMA's on Houston), velvety red lounge.

Time Out New York
"Creating a successful bar doen't always require installing a high-end state of the art sound system or hiring a big name designer: Sometimes it has more to do with finding a good secondhand store. When owners Amy McClosky, Mimi Dimur and Teresa Rovito decided on a bordello like atmosphere for the subterranean Madame X, they hit the city's flea markets and Salvation Army stores and discovered lots of choice couches and chairs. Dimure re-covered the furniture in plush velvets and completed the space with red lighting and a bar rimmed in red fur. The result is a lounge that allows you to relax, carry on a conversation and even be a bit naughty. "Every time there's been a crowd here," laughs McClosky, "there's always some couple making out in the corner."
